[0030] The present invention designs a focal plane adjustment closed-loop control system applied to 3D printing equipment. In practical application, it specifically includes a control module, an image capture device, a displacement sensor, and a PLC electric control module.
[0031] Wherein, the image capture device is arranged directly above the 3D printing substrate, and the image capture direction of the image capture device is vertically downward, which is used to realize real-time image capture for the 3D printing processing plane, obtain the captured image, and upload it to the control module; actually In the application, the image capture device is designed to use a high-speed CCD camera.
